The Women's 200m Individual Medley event at the 11th FINA World Aquatics Championships swam on 24 and 25 July 2005 in Montreal, Canada. Preliminary[1] and Semifinals[2] heats were 24 July; the Final[3] was 25 July.

Results

Final

Place Swimmer Nation Time Notes
1 Katie Hoff  USA 2:10.41 CR
2 Kirsty Coventry  Zimbabwe 2:11.13
3 Lara Carroll  Australia 2:13.32
4 Whitney Myers  USA 2:13.90
5 Katarzyna Baranowska  Poland 2:14.39
6 Brooke Hanson  Australia 2:14.70
7 Maiko Fujino  Japan 2:15.27
8 Zsuzsanna Jakabos  Hungary 2:16.09
